Make math FUN with these 2nd grade math riddles and jokes!! This packet is Common Core aligned for 2nd grade but can also be used as remediation or enrichment for 1st or 3rd grade classrooms as well. There are a total of 15 riddles/jokes in this pack. Answer keys are also included!!

Students are presented with a joke and or a riddle and must solve the math problems in order to learn the answers. For example:

Q: I have lots of keys, but I can't open anything. What am I?
A: a piano

Q: What can you serve but never eat?
A: a volleyball

Math with a purpose!! These sheets are great for practicing math skills and demonstrating mastery. My students absolutely LOVE these practice pages. They are great for morning work, centers, or even homework!

The following math skills are covered in this packet:

(2) Two Digit Addition (without regrouping)
(2) Two Digit Addition (with & without regrouping)
(2) Two Digit Subtraction (without regrouping)
(1) Two Digit Mixed Addition & Subtraction (without regrouping)
(2) Adding Tens & Hundreds
(2) Subtracting Tens & Hundreds
(2) Counting by 5's
(2) Counting by 10's
